Labview中关于读取txt文本文件,读出来是乱码的问题。

在LabVIEW中处理TXT文件时遇到中文乱码问题,可以通过将文件另存为ANSI编码或使用UTF-8至TXT转换工具来解决。第一种方法是将TXT转为ANSI编码,第二种方法涉及使用数组进行UTF-8和TXT之间的转换。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

    在用labview做登录界面的时候,发现TXT文件无论用带分隔符的电子表格还是用读取文本文件函数,文件中的中文内容都会出现乱码现象,如下图所示:

 ​​​​​​​

 

 

  在这里可以用2种方法来解决这个问题,

  第一种是首先方法,即将TXT文件编码方式另存为ANSI编码的TXT文件,这样使用这个文件能得到我们想要的文字结果,如下图所示:

 

 

  第二种是使用UTF-8至TXT转换,缺点是使用到数组的时候需要多次索引数组。如下图所示:​​​​​​​

 

    我已将UTF-8转TXT和TXT转UTF-8的VI放到文章资源中,需要的可以自行下载。

评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值